AUSTRALIAN NEWS.

REORGANISING' UNIONISM. Australian Cable Association.' , Sydney, April 19. The Labor Council has adopted a ne\l reorganisation scheme for unionism. Op» position was shown on the grounds that the scheme abolished craft unionism and left the control in the liands of the directors, practically making meetings of members unnecessary. The scheme has been sent to various unions for consideration.

The council decided to cable to Mr. Lloyd George a protest against conscrip, tion in Ireland.
